Tahini Hummus w/Fresh P♡M Arils
Yield: +2 qt
Ingredients:
- 1½# Cooked chickpeas
(soak overnight, drain and boil until tender, cooking times will vary)
- 6 fl oz Extra virgin olive oil
- ¾ c Lemon Juice
- ½ c Lime Juice
- 4 clvs Garlic, Salt crushed
- 1~ c Tahini
- a/n Kosher Salt
- 1 ¾ c P♡M Pomegranate Arils
- a/n Parsley, Mint
- a/n Pita Chips
- Boil and drain Chickpeas until tender, 1-2 hr, Reserve cooking liquid
- In a food processor, blend Chickpeas with ~1c of cooking liquid until smooth
- Add Lemon juice, EVOO, Garlic, Tahini and Salt.
- Adjust seasoning.
- Add Lime Juice, Mint, and Cilantro
- Fold in 1c Fresh P♡M Pomegranate Arils. Save rest for garnish.
- Serve with home made Pita Chips
